Logic 'Everybody'

The long awaited album from Logic has finally hit the shelves and I for one am excited. The journey that Logic has been through has been one only a few would be able to live through from selling drugs to his family, shootings, racial abuse and living in a household full of people bringing him down and even so, he went through all of this shit he still came out on top and became an amazing artist.

All throughout this album he explains how people hated on him for 'acting black' when he has white skin and white people being racist towards him because he has a black dad and how he came on top of it and is now spreading the message of love, positivity and equality. This can be see in 'Take it Back', he ends the song with the chilling message off 'stop killing each other'. A lot of people hate on Logic for a number of different reason but in my opinion, if someone is making music that thousands or even millions of people listen too, spreading a positive message of loving yourself and treating people fairly then i'm gunna fuck with it.

The skits are something that I think makes this album come together. The way logic has used the idea of the meaning to life through every racial minority, every privileged position, every gender and seeing life through so many perspectives as possible to then mature to become something so understanding and greater to teach others that at the end of the day, we are all going to the same place whether you believe in heaven, hell, purgatory or reincarnation.

The album doesn't disappoint and I hugely recommend it.
